解决sdkmanager 没有 --licenses 和 --version。 update只显示 done

感谢大神
codeBrick123:

原文地址

https://blog.csdn.net/u010165147/article/details/82496617

直接说解决方法,sdkmanager --update 没有用,但还是升级一下比较好

 

以下是大神原话:

windows下把tools文件夹改成tools2

cmd进入tools2\bin文件夹

 执行命令:sdkmanager --include_obsolete "tools"

删掉tools2文件夹。再用sdkmanager --help就发现所有命令都回来了

 

补充一下

上述步骤完成之后会有个小问题,就是 sdkmanager 和模拟器管理界面 打不开了,怎么升级 sdkmanager 都没用,我怀疑 24之后的版本可能安卓不提供 sdkmanager 管理界面了。  所以上面的办法只适用于习惯于操作命令行而又不想安装android studio的小伙伴。  

如果不想那么麻烦,还想用vscode或eclipse写安卓,那直接安装一个AS就好了,只为搭建环境嘛

 

posted @ 2021-01-08 10:30  Yinniora  阅读(1360)  评论(0)    收藏  举报